What is a Pipe Size Calculator?

A Pipe Size Calculator is a tool used to calculate the diameter of a pipe required to carry a specific flow rate of fluid at a given velocity. It is widely used in plumbing systems, irrigation, HVAC systems, and industrial pipelines.

Formula:
D = √(4Q / πV)

Why Pipe Size Matters

Selecting the correct pipe size is critical for system performance. If the pipe is too small, it can cause high pressure loss and reduced flow. If it is too large, it increases cost unnecessarily.

Key Factors in Pipe Sizing

1. Flow Rate

Flow rate is the volume of fluid passing through a pipe per unit time. It is usually measured in liters per second or cubic meters per second.

2. Velocity

Velocity is the speed at which fluid moves through the pipe. Recommended velocity depends on the application.

3. Pipe Material

Different materials like PVC, steel, and copper have different friction characteristics.

4. Pressure

Pressure plays a key role in determining the required pipe size.

How to Calculate Pipe Size

Follow these steps to calculate pipe diameter:

Example:

Flow Rate = 0.05 m³/s
Velocity = 2 m/s

D = √(4 × 0.05 / (3.1416 × 2)) = 0.178 m
